Indoor Volleyball Development Council

The Indoor Volleyball Development Council  (IVDC) is a subcommittee of the Regional Council. 

The IVDC’s purpose is to review initiatives about the development of indoor volleyball and to provide operational and strategic advice in areas such as, but not limited to: 

  • athlete development
  • coach development
  • competition structure
  • grassroots programming 

The IVDC will comprise a minimum of 7 and no more than 9 appointed members, plus the following ex officio members:

  • the Director, Regional Engagement
  • the Athletes’ Representative
  • the OVA Executive Director
  • the OVA Director, Athlete Development
  • the OVA Director of Operations

OVA staff members and the Athletes’ Representative are non-voting members.

Desired skills and experiences of appointees include, but are not limited to, the following:

  • Experience as a coach or administrator
  • Post-secondary volleyball experience
  • Experience volunteering on an OVA regional executive
  • Knowledge of the Long Term Development (LTD) model
  • Experience with developmental volleyball (grassroots)
  • Official / Referee

The selection of members will also consider geographic representation.

Members are appointed for one-year terms, which are renewable at the discretion of the Director, of Regional Engagement.

Key areas of responsibility include:

  • LTD Based Competition Structure Review
    • Ongoing evaluation of the OVA’s competition structure for Train to Train and Learn to Compete athletes in relation to the LTD recommendations
  • Athlete Development
    • To assess the state of athlete development within OVA clubs and make recommendations about resources/tools that could be made available for clubs
  • Coach Development
    • To make recommendations on non-NCCP coach development programs

The IVDC may establish working groups on the above topics or on other aspects of volleyball development.

Regional Coach Development Subcommittee

The Regional Coach Development Subcommittee (RCDS) is a subcommittee of the Regional Council.

The RCDS’s purpose is to develop, review and implement non-NCCP regional coach development activities for the coaches of the six OVA regions.

The RCDS will be composed of a minimum of 3 and no more than 6 appointees. In addition, the OVA Athlete Development Director is an ex officio, non-voting member.

The Director of Regional Engagement will appoint the RCDS members, and may either act as the RCDS Chair or designate one of the appointees to act as Chair.

Desired skills and experiences of appointees include, but are not limited to, the following:

  • Experience as a coach at the club level in beach or indoor volleyball
  • Experience with coach development as a NCCP Coach Developer
  • Experience mentoring coaches
  • Knowledge of OVA and Volleyball Canada coach development pathways
  • Knowledge of the Long Term Development Model

All members must comply with the OVA Screening Policy and the OVA Conflict of Interest Policy.

Key areas of responsibility include:

  • Non-NCCP Coach Development activities
    • The committee will develop and implement coach development activities to be held in the regions to support OVA coaches throughout the province. They will make suggestions to the regional chairs about how the regional funds could be used effectively for the development of coaches.
  • Assessing project proposals from OVA staff
    • The OVA Executive Director will identify an OVA staff liaison to provide coach-development proposals to the RCDS for consideration. The RCDS will review these proposals and make recommendations as to how the proposed activities could be run in the regions. The RCDS will also make recommendations as to the use of regional funds to support these projects.

The RCDS may establish working groups on the above topics or on other aspects of coach development.

About the OVA Regional Council

The overall role of the Regions is to collaborate and cooperate to help grow the sport of volleyball in Ontario by integrating the OVA’s strategic plan into programs and drawing on the expertise within the Regions to strengthen programming.

As each Region may have unique situations and environments that require attention and can enhance different aspects of the integration of OVA’s strategic plan, there needs to be a strong partnership with the Regions to realize the OVA’s vision to provide a fun, safe and rewarding environment through a commitment to Volleyball for Life.  

The Regional Council act as an advisory body to the Ontario Volleyball Association’s Board of Directors and OVA management with respect to regional issues of significance.  They ensure that the Board and OVA management understand regional issues, and ensure that the Regions understand the Board and OVA management’s perspectives; and ensure effective sharing of information within individual Regions and between the Regions, the Board, and OVA management.
